Introduction to Affiliate Marketing

Affiliate marketing is a performance-based marketing strategy where you earn a commission by promoting other companies’ products. It’s an ideal opportunity for those who want to monetize their online presence. 🌟 Whether you have a blog, YouTube channel, or social media platform, affiliate marketing can add an income stream to your digital endeavors.

How Does Affiliate Marketing Work?

Here’s a simple breakdown of how affiliate marketing operates:

1. Join an Affiliate Program: You sign up for an affiliate program and receive a unique affiliate link.
2. Promote Products: Share this link on your platform, recommending products or services to your audience.
3. Earn Commissions: When someone clicks on your link and makes a purchase, you earn a commission. 💰

The beauty of affiliate marketing lies in its simplicity and scalability. You can promote multiple products across various platforms, maximizing your earnings potential.

Choosing Your Niche

Before diving into affiliate marketing, it’s crucial to choose a niche that aligns with your interests and expertise. 🤔 Consider the following factors:

Passion and Knowledge: What topics are you passionate about and knowledgeable in? This will make content creation enjoyable and authentic.

Market Demand: Research whether there is a demand for your chosen niche. Use tools like Google Trends or keyword research to gauge interest levels.

Competition: Analyze the competition. A highly competitive niche might be challenging for beginners, while a niche with little competition might lack profitability.

Joining Affiliate Programs in Australia

Once you’ve chosen your niche, it’s time to join affiliate programs. Here are some popular affiliate networks in Australia:

1. Commission Factory: A leading affiliate network in Australia, offering a wide range of products and services.
2. Rakuten Advertising: Known for its global reach and variety of merchants.
3. Amazon Australia Associates: Offers a vast selection of products to promote, ideal for many niches. 🛒

Research and apply to programs that align with your niche and target audience.

Building Your Platform

Your platform is where you’ll promote affiliate products. This could be a blog, YouTube channel, or social media account. Here are some tips for building a successful platform:

Create Quality Content: Focus on providing value to your audience through informative and engaging content. 🎥

Optimize for SEO: Use relevant keywords in your content to improve search engine visibility. This will drive organic traffic to your platform.

Engage with Your Audience: Foster a community by responding to comments and encouraging interaction. This builds trust and loyalty. 🤝

Creating Valuable Content

Content is king in affiliate marketing. Here’s how to create content that converts:

Product Reviews: Provide honest and detailed reviews of products you promote. Highlight both pros and cons to build credibility. ⭐

Tutorials and Guides: Create how-to guides that demonstrate the use of products, showcasing their benefits to your audience.

Comparison Articles: Compare similar products, helping your audience make informed purchasing decisions.

Driving Traffic to Your Platform

More traffic means more potential sales. Here are some strategies to boost your traffic:

SEO Optimization: Continuously optimize your content with keywords and backlinks to improve search engine rankings.

Social Media Promotion: Share your content on social media platforms to reach a wider audience. 📱

Email Marketing: Build an email list and send newsletters featuring your content and affiliate products.

FAQs

1. How much can I earn with affiliate marketing in Australia?

The earning potential varies based on your niche, audience size, and engagement. Some affiliates earn a few hundred dollars a month, while others make a full-time income.

2. Do I need a website to start affiliate marketing?

While having a website is beneficial, it’s not mandatory. You can use social media platforms or YouTube to promote affiliate products.

3. How do I choose the right affiliate program?

Consider factors like commission rates, product relevance to your niche, and the reputation of the affiliate network.

4. Are there any costs involved in affiliate marketing?

Starting affiliate marketing is relatively low-cost. However, investing in a website, marketing tools, or paid promotions can enhance your efforts.

5. How long does it take to see results in affiliate marketing?

Results can vary, but generally, it takes a few months to start seeing consistent income. Patience and persistence are crucial.
